Background

Scope and content:

Various documents and publications relating to funding and fundraising activities of a number of Santa Barbara-based educational and charitable organizations including UCSB, Direct Relief International, Santa Barbara Botanic Garden, Marymount School, and Francheschi House, among others.

Acquisition information:
Gift of Robert E. Bason, 2014.
